Judgment text excerpt
The Supreme Court upheld the conviction of the appellants under Sections 302 and 364 read with Section 34 IPC, affirming the life imprisonment and fines imposed by the trial court. The Court found sufficient evidence linking the appellants to the abduction and murder of the victim, Jagram, including the recovery of a rope used in the crime. The judgment emphasized the importance of corroborative evidence in establishing guilt beyond reasonable doubt, thereby affirming the lower court's findings and dismissing the appeals.
